TRUE WISDOM

barrie visit 2011 356

September 28
________________________________________
But the wisdom from above is first of all pure. It is also peace loving, gentle at all times and willing to yield to others. It is full of mercy and good deeds. It shows no favoritism and is always sincere. – James 3:17(NLT)
TRUE WISDOM
A poem and essay by ILMA
True wisdom comes from knowing God
It is good and focuses on manifesting love
It shows no favoritism and is peace loving
It displays mercy and is always yielding.
True wisdom from above is pure and sincere
It is simple, never hazy but always clear
It leads us to a life that lasts forever
It truly makes us grow closer to our creator.
________________________________________
The world we live in today focuses much on acquisition of knowledge. It sets a standard for people to ensure that they follow the world’s ways. It emphasizes a focus on the “self” rather than on truth. The book of James gives us a clear picture of what true wisdom from above is. It is pure and uncorrupted by the world’s measuring stick. When you have the wisdom that comes from God, it is peace loving, gentle and willing to yield to others. In other words, it is not selfish. It is merciful and shows no biases and is always honest and sincere. Many people mistake knowledge for wisdom. They are not the same. We can only have true wisdom when we apply the truth that comes from God’s word.

My father was a surveyor and worked abroad for many years. I grew up without his presence in my life. I would miss him so much that there were nights that I would wake up from nightmares, screaming his name and wanting him to be beside me. There were nights that I am easy to pacify, but sometimes I would just be sick from longing for my daddy. Have you ever longed for someone so much that you can’t wait to be with that person?
The bible talks to us about how much we need to yearn for Jesus. This verse shows how the psalmist was so longing for God’s word and yearning deeply for him.
